Output 447594de47a7ceb22d9dad8f0a3ccddb6500621f56f4f5db31c8290c76635bd6:11

value
20956404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3ebf9cc477d54f5f4c4744c877fbd1aa964c984 OP_EQUAL
address
3Pvkp3Rwh75pCeNJVezgrZQizt9ry3v17o
transaction
447594de47a7ceb22d9dad8f0a3ccddb6500621f56f4f5db31c8290c76635bd6
confirmations
466517
spent
true